Use the useReducer Hook and Dispatch Actions to Update State

Elijah Manor
InstructorElijah Manor
  • react
    React

Share this video with your friends

Send Tweet

As an alternate to useState, you could also use the useReducer hook that provides state and a dispatch method for triggering actions. In this lesson, we’ll centralize logic that is spread across a web application and centralize it using the useReducer hook.
